Likiep Atoll, located in the Marshall Islands, is a hidden paradise waiting to be explored. With its pristine white sandy beaches, crystal-clear turquoise waters, and vibrant coral reefs, this destination is a dream for snorkelers and divers. Immerse yourself in the rich culture and history of the local Marshallese people, known for their warm hospitality. Explore the lush tropical landscapes, dotted with coconut palms and colorful flowers. Relax on secluded beaches and witness breathtaking sunsets over the Pacific Ocean. Visa & Travel Information for Likiep Atoll

  • 1. Visa Requirements
    • Most visitors can enter the Marshall Islands without a visa for stays up to 90 days.
    • Check if your country has specific visa requirements.
  • 2. Travel Requirements
    • A valid passport with at least 6 months of validity remaining.
    • A return or onward ticket may be required.
    • Proof of sufficient funds for your stay.
  • 3. Health Requirements
    • No specific vaccinations are required, but it's good to be up to date on routine vaccines.
    • Check for any travel advisories or health notices before traveling.
  • 4. Other Considerations
    • Ensure to check local regulations or restrictions related to COVID-19 or other health concerns before your trip.

About “Virtual Interlining”: Some itineraries may combine multiple airlines without a traditional interline agreement. This can unlock routes that are otherwise hard to find, but it can also increase complexity (separate tickets, tighter connections, baggage rules, and responsibility for missed connections).
